Entrepreneurial universities increasingly function as institutional coordinators in innovation ecosystems by reducing commercialisation frictions through governance, intellectual property (IP) support, and industry linkage capacity. This study examines Kosovo as a small and emerging economy where ecosystem constraints—limited commercialisation infrastructure, weak research–industry interfaces, and fragmented entrepreneurship pipelines—may amplify the marginal returns of university technology transfer capacity. The paper develops an indicator-based framework to operationalise technology transfer office (TTO) activity as a composite index capturing IP support, partnership throughput, mentorship intensity, and pipeline governance. Using an internally consistent demonstrative dataset to illustrate a replicable analytic workflow, the study evaluates descriptive associations between TTO activity, university spinout formation, and a growth proxy. Results indicate strong alignment between higher TTO activity and increased spinout formation (Figure 1; Table 1). To support present versus near-future comparisons, the paper incorporates macroeconomic benchmarks: Kosovo’s real GDP growth reached 4.4% in 2024 and is expected to be 3.8% in both 2025 and 2026, while the IMF reports 2025 projected growth of 3.9% (Figure 2; Table 2). The paper concludes with a scalable entrepreneurial university model and a KPI dashboard suitable for ecosystem governance in transitional economies.
